John H. Addison, age 70, passed away Wednesday, January 9, 2019. He was born April 28, 1948 in Lebanon, VA to the late Howard and Nell (Kiser) Addison. John lived most of his life in Baltimore, Ohio and graduated from Liberty Union High School in 1966.
John was a two-time war veteran, having served in the U.S. Navy during Vietnam and the Air National Guard Refueling Squadron at Rickenbacker Air Force Base during Operation Desert Storm. He retired first from Lucent Technologies and, more recently, from Ryder Logistics. John volunteered at Fairfield Medical Center and was a member of Linville Community Church.
